The name of the company is "HomeGrownAudio", and their 999.999% pure, all-silver cables sell for $70 per 1-meter pair, or $40 in DIY kit form (you do the assembly and soldering). Their lower-priced interconnect has silver positive leads, and copper negative returns (ala the Kimber Silver Streak), and are priced at $40 ($24 for DIY kit). I bought three of these (silver) kits and assembled them, using lead free high silver content solder. They come with braided wire now which is convenient since the braiding process was the only thing part of the process where I could have used three hands. RCA's were of high quality. I added some additional shrink tube from Radio Shack and did a direct A/B with AQ Quartz. Only difference - little less prominent bass which is no big deal since I just turned the powered subs up a notch. Bottom line is this - they're a steal at $39 for the silver kit with RCA's.
